Messaging & Off-Platform Rules (Why Staying On Guruu Matters)

Why you should keep messaging, booking and payments on-platform and what to do if someone tries to move you elsewhere.

Messaging happens within Guruu so your conversation, booking, and session context stays in one place.

Why it matters: on-platform messaging protects you with clearer evidence and support pathways.

How it works: message a Guruu → agree on goal/time → book in-platform → keep updates in the same thread.

Good to know: write your goal clearly in messages — it becomes the shared reference if there's confusion later.

Because moving off-platform removes the protections that make marketplaces safer. Guruu prohibits attempts to pay, contact, or schedule outside the platform.

Why it matters: off-platform increases scam risk and reduces your options if something goes wrong.

How it works: keep comms and payments on-platform → only book through Guruu.

Good to know: most marketplace scams begin with "move off-platform."

Don't move. Ask to keep everything on Guruu. If they persist, report it and stop engaging.

Why it matters: persistent off-platform requests are a common scam and policy-breach pattern.

How it works: "Happy to keep this on Guruu" → continue in-platform → report if needed.

Good to know: staying on-platform keeps your protections and makes disputes resolvable.

Guruu requires payments and communication to occur through the platform, and attempts to move contact or scheduling outside Guruu may result in suspension or removal.

Why it matters: moving off-platform compromises dispute and safety protections.

How it works: keep follow-ups on Guruu → keep scheduling and payments on Guruu.

Good to know: if you want ongoing sessions, keeping it on Guruu also keeps your booking history and reviews intact.
